how are platelets drawn to area of damaged vessel?
Damage to the blood vessel -> barrier is broken -> exposes underlying very adhesive proteins e.g. collagen -> platelets recognise this & stick to the area using VWFactor
Role of VWf
Acts as an anchor to platelets
what happens when platelets adhere to a region?
Platelets change: develop increased surface area, sudopodia (can stick in neatly & perform their function)
On top of that more platelets accumulate

how do we ensure that the haemostasis testing is accurate?
by ensuring the quality of the specimen submitted:
Blood is anticoagulated with 3.2 % (0.109 M) Sodium citrate
Most tubes contain 0.3 mL anticoagulant and require 2.7 mLs of blood.
